Mitsubishi Estate to Launch “Logicross Nagoya Minato,” One of Western Japan’s Largest Amazon Fulfillment Centers

On July 1, Mitsubishi Estate announced its latest logistics facility under the “Logicross” brand: Logicross Nagoya Minato, slated to begin operations in August 2025. With a gross floor area of approximately 37,900 tsubo (approx. 125,200 sq. ft.), it will become one of the largest Amazon-dedicated fulfillment centers (FCs) in western Japan.
The four-story facility is located just a 3-minute walk from Arakogawa Koen Station on the Aonami Line and is near the Komei Interchange of the Nagoya Expressway Route 4 Tokai Line. Designed in collaboration with Amazon, the project features 5.5 MW of solar panels installed on the roof and southern façade, and utilizes 200 underground heat exchangers reaching 100 meters deep to reduce energy consumption by approximately 30% compared to conventional standards.
The building has already obtained a BELS 6-Star certification and is expected to achieve Zero Carbon Certification by the Living Future Institute in 2026 based on post-occupancy performance data. Under its sustainability vision “Be the Ecosystem Engineers,” Mitsubishi Estate positions the Logicross series as a showcase for cutting-edge environmental technologies, aiming to balance asset value with social impact.
Amazon plans to implement advanced robotics and automated packaging systems at the site, with the goal of creating thousands of new jobs and strengthening its regional delivery network.
